We compared two Desktop platform GPUs: 8GB VRAM Radeon RX 580 OEM and 2GB VRAM NVS 510 to see which GPU has better performance in key specifications, benchmark tests, power consumption, etc.
Main Differences
AMD Radeon RX 580 OEM 's Advantages
Released 3 years and 8 months late
Boost Clock1266MHz
More VRAM (8GB vs 2GB)
Larger VRAM bandwidth (256.0GB/s vs 28.51GB/s)
2112 additional rendering cores
NVIDIA NVS 510 's Advantages
Lower TDP (35W vs 150W)
